Question

A 5.30-kg object is initially movingso that its x-component of velocity is 6.00 m/s andy-component of velocity is -1.80 m/s.

(a) What is the kinetic energy of the object atthis time? (Joules)
1

(b) Find the change in kinetic energy of the object it itsvelocity changes so that its new x-component is 8.50 m/sand its new y-component is 5.00 m/s. (Joules)
